Unraveling the complexities of programming neural adaptive deep brain stimulation in Parkinson’s disease
Over the past three decades, deep brain stimulation (DBS) for Parkinson’s disease (PD) has been applied in a continuous open loop fashion, unresponsive to changes in a given patient’s state or symptoms over the course of a day.
